How To Level Health
Health is one of the few skills in Escape From Tarkov that increases as you earn experience points in other skills. For health this is endurance, strength and vitality which all have easy to execute levelling methods alongside your passive activities from raids that benefit these.
For those looking to focus on health urgently for quest or hideout requirements your best option is to combine the methods to level strength and endurance linked above as these are powerful skills in their own right which makes them worth investing in and are the lower effort of the 3 options.
An often overlooked strategy to levelling health is to take advantage of the Therapist’s, An Apple A Day quest which provides 2 levels of health and should be taken at health level 8 as the required skill points in skill levelling increase at higher levels. Completing this quest is straightforward, requiring players to hand over 400,000 Roubles and will allow players to reach the required level 10 for quests noted below.
Health Requirements (Quest & Hideout)
Health in Tarkov is used for the following:
- Level 2 health is required for players to construct the level 2 medstation in the hideout.
- Level 4 health is required to complete the Therapist’s quest Health Care Privacy – Part 4.
- Level 10 health is required to complete the Therapist’s quest Athlete.
Your overall progression can be stalled if the health skill levels lag behind, especially for the crucial hideout medstation upgrade. For the bulk of players though it will be the quests on their path to the Kappa Secure Container that will mean they need to spend some of their raid time focusing on this skill. Health Care Privacy Part 4 is particularly important as it leads to the quest Private Clinic that gives one of the best Tarkov quest rewards in the THICC item case.
Benefits Of Health Levels
Health provides the following PMC benefits:
- Decreases chance of fractures
- Decreases energy consumption and dehydration rates while in raid
- Damage absorption (Elite)
The health skill provide quality of life to your raid experience with less fractures leading to less healing items and significantly reduces the chances you’ll start limping from a fracture mid fight. The benefits of lower energy consumption and dehydration are also convenient as you’ll be able to raid for longer without worrying about bringing or finding provisions.
The elite health skill benefit of damage absorption is currently not implemented and there has been no documented plans from BattleState Games to introduce this yet.
